Address Pulse
The address pulse signals the modules to either accept or
ignore the control pulse. The address pulse matches one of
the existing pulses (see Table 3). If the pulse does not match
the address of a given module, that module ignores the
control pulse and continues operating according to the most
recent control pulse addressed to it.

a
The 2.65-second time base is appropriate only for multiplex operation when the BAS controller guarantees PWM output
accuracy of 0.05 second or better.
b
When shipped from the factory, the device is set to Multiplex Address 1. This is also the setting used with only one
Q7002 connected to a controller (no multiplexing).
Control Pulse
The control pulse carries the signal to adjust the control of the
addressed module. Control is based in direct proportion to the
control signal.
For Example:
A Q7002C operating with a 5.2 second time base
that received a 6.2 second attention pulse and the
proper address pulse receives a 5.2 second control
pulse. This results in module output of 100 percent. If
the same module were to receive a 2.6 second
control pulse, it would adjust the output to 50
percent.
